Official Obituary of
Marion R. Gessert Mayer
March 17, 1926 ~ July 19, 2019 (age 93) 93 Years Old

Marion Mayer, the former Marion Gessert, 93 of Plymouth was born March 17, 1926 in the city of Plymouth, a daughter of Hugo and Edna Kracht Gessert. Marion passed away on Friday, July 19th, 2019 at Pine Haven Christian Home.Marion attended Plymouth Grade School and graduated from Plymouth High School in 1944. On September 14, 1946, she married Ralph Mayer at Plymouth Reformed Church. The couple lived one year on the Mayer homestead in the Town of Rhine and then moved to Plymouth. She did office work at the Local Draft Board No. 3 at Plymouth and was Plant Secretary of the District Commonwealth Telephone Co. office until March 1951. She also worked several years for Tupper Cheese Co. From 1958 until retiring in 1986 she worked with her husband doing the office work for their business, Ralph Mayer Painting, Inc. She was a life-long member of Salem United Church of Christ, Plymouth, and volunteered in several capacities, including being a Sunday school teacher and a member of the Willing Workers.She and her husband celebrated their 50th wedding anniversary September 14, 1996. They were married 62 years at the time of his death on April 8, 2009. They enjoyed many hours of dancing and playing cards with family and friends. She was happiest when the entire family was together. Mom did a lot of embroidery work, wrote poetry, and loved to travel.Marion was a loving mother of two daughters, Susan (Robert) Mayer-Livingston of Shaker Heights, OH and Karen (Kenneth) Lynch of Beach Park, IL; one son: Romy (Amy) Mayer of New Berlin, WI; six grandchildren Ryan & Whitney Livingston, Meghan & Samantha Mayer, Tracy Lynch and Amy (Jaime) Jensen; four great grandchildren, Matthew, Brandon, Jacob and, Alyssa. She is further survived by a sister, Doris (Albert) Hanke of Howards Grove, WI.
